Since It Can't Sue Us All, Getty Images Embraces Embedded Photos

For the past decade or so, the best defense Getty Images could find against the right-click button on your mouse—home of the “copy” and “save” functions—has been a team of scary lawyers. By copying one of its images and using it on your blog, you’re entering a random drawing where the prize is a terrifying letter offering a tutorial in copyright litigation.

Creating an embedding tool is a tacit acknowledgment that Getty simply can’t police the use of its images to the four corners of the Internet.
